What Indian students should check

Use this checklist before you make a decision, pay money, accept work, travel, or sign documents in Australia.

  • Attend sessions for international students, course enrolment, library, and safety.
  • Find student services, health support, counselling, career help, and emergency contacts.
  • Check student card, transport concessions, timetable, and campus maps.
  • Join communities without sharing personal or financial details too quickly.

Practical next steps

Keep the process simple: verify the official requirement, save evidence, and act early if something feels unclear.

  • Save campus support contacts in your phone.
  • Walk your main class route before the first day.
